So we made the trek from Gentilly through Mid-City to Uptown to try out The Company Burger on Freret, one of the many burger places that have sprouted up in New Orleans in the past year. New Orleans, we had to ask ourselves why were we just now trying The Company Burger for the first time!
Let us explain…you know how ya mama or auntie or whoever makes them homemade patties and homemade French fries? And when you eat them, you get this indescribable feeling that neither McDonald’s nor Burger King can EVER give you? Well, we got that feeling at The Company Burger. We had “The Company Burger” (the classic American cheeseburger - two patties, bread & butter pickles, American cheese, and red onions), “The Single” (bread and butter pickles, American cheese, and red onions), “Lamb Burger” (feta, house basil mayonnaise, red onions, chili mint glaze), “The Company fries,” some “Cane Sugar Coca-Cola” in a bottle, and a can of Abita Amber. And so the journey began…
New Orleans, please don’t tell our mama or our auntie, but these might be the best damn burgers and fries in the whole city! Locally baked buns, antibiotic- and hormone-free beef, local produce (tomatoes, okra, etc.) when available, and a condiment bar to make you go a little crazy, it’s truly a shame that there’s not a Company Burger closer to the IntheNOLA offices in Mid-City (hey, maybe you guys wanna look into that :) ).
